Frequently Asked Questions

WebP is a modern image format developed by Google that provides superior lossless and lossy compression for images on the web. Using WebP, webmasters and developers can create smaller, richer images that make the web faster without sacrificing visual quality.

On average, WebP images are 25% to 34% smaller than comparable JPEG images at an equivalent quality index. Depending on the settings you choose on our compression slider, you can often cut your file size in half with virtually no visible quality loss.

Yes! The WebP format is universally supported across all modern web browsers, including Chrome, Safari, Firefox, Edge, and mobile browsers. It has become the gold standard for high-performance web publishing.

It depends entirely on the compression level you choose. A quality setting of 80-90% usually produces an image virtually indistinguishable from the original JPG but at a fraction of the file size. Setting it to 100% results in maximum quality, while lower settings will show compression artifacts.
